October daylight summary
- Sunrise shifts 18m later from the start to the end of the month.
- Sunset shifts 30m earlier from the start to the end of the month.
- Total daylight changes by 48m shorter by month end.
Key October Statistics
- Earliest sunrise: October 1 at 7:23 AM
- Latest sunrise: October 31 at 7:41 AM
- Earliest sunset: October 1 at 7:19 PM
- Latest sunset: October 31 at 6:49 PM
- Day length change: -1h 48m from start to end of month
October averages
- Average sunrise: 7:32 AM
- Average sunset: 7:03 PM
- Average day length: 11h 32m

Daily Sun Times for October 2026
| Date | Sunrise | Sunset | Day Length | Morning Golden Hour | Evening Golden Hour |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Oct 1 | 7:23 AM | 7:19 PM | 11h 56m | 7:23 AM - 7:54 AM | 6:48 PM - 7:19 PM |
| Oct 2 | 7:24 AM | 7:18 PM | 11h 54m | 7:24 AM - 7:55 AM | 6:47 PM - 7:18 PM |
| Oct 3 | 7:24 AM | 7:17 PM | 11h 52m | 7:24 AM - 7:55 AM | 6:46 PM - 7:17 PM |
| Oct 4 | 7:25 AM | 7:16 PM | 11h 51m | 7:25 AM - 7:56 AM | 6:45 PM - 7:16 PM |
| Oct 5 | 7:25 AM | 7:15 PM | 11h 49m | 7:25 AM - 7:57 AM | 6:43 PM - 7:15 PM |
| Oct 6 | 7:26 AM | 7:13 PM | 11h 47m | 7:26 AM - 7:57 AM | 6:42 PM - 7:13 PM |
| Oct 7 | 7:26 AM | 7:12 PM | 11h 46m | 7:26 AM - 7:58 AM | 6:41 PM - 7:12 PM |
| Oct 8 | 7:27 AM | 7:11 PM | 11h 44m | 7:27 AM - 7:58 AM | 6:40 PM - 7:11 PM |
| Oct 9 | 7:27 AM | 7:10 PM | 11h 43m | 7:27 AM - 7:59 AM | 6:39 PM - 7:10 PM |
| Oct 10 | 7:28 AM | 7:09 PM | 11h 41m | 7:28 AM - 7:59 AM | 6:38 PM - 7:09 PM |
| Oct 11 | 7:29 AM | 7:08 PM | 11h 39m | 7:29 AM - 8:00 AM | 6:37 PM - 7:08 PM |
| Oct 12 | 7:29 AM | 7:07 PM | 11h 38m | 7:29 AM - 8:00 AM | 6:36 PM - 7:07 PM |
| Oct 13 | 7:30 AM | 7:06 PM | 11h 36m | 7:30 AM - 8:01 AM | 6:34 PM - 7:06 PM |
| Oct 14 | 7:30 AM | 7:05 PM | 11h 35m | 7:30 AM - 8:02 AM | 6:33 PM - 7:05 PM |
| Oct 15 | 7:31 AM | 7:04 PM | 11h 33m | 7:31 AM - 8:02 AM | 6:32 PM - 7:04 PM |
| Oct 16 | 7:31 AM | 7:03 PM | 11h 31m | 7:31 AM - 8:03 AM | 6:31 PM - 7:03 PM |
| Oct 17 | 7:32 AM | 7:02 PM | 11h 30m | 7:32 AM - 8:03 AM | 6:30 PM - 7:02 PM |
| Oct 18 | 7:32 AM | 7:01 PM | 11h 28m | 7:32 AM - 8:04 AM | 6:29 PM - 7:01 PM |
| Oct 19 | 7:33 AM | 7:00 PM | 11h 27m | 7:33 AM - 8:05 AM | 6:28 PM - 7:00 PM |
| Oct 20 | 7:34 AM | 6:59 PM | 11h 25m | 7:34 AM - 8:05 AM | 6:27 PM - 6:59 PM |
| Oct 21 | 7:34 AM | 6:58 PM | 11h 23m | 7:34 AM - 8:06 AM | 6:26 PM - 6:58 PM |
| Oct 22 | 7:35 AM | 6:57 PM | 11h 22m | 7:35 AM - 8:07 AM | 6:25 PM - 6:57 PM |
| Oct 23 | 7:35 AM | 6:56 PM | 11h 20m | 7:35 AM - 8:07 AM | 6:24 PM - 6:56 PM |
| Oct 24 | 7:36 AM | 6:55 PM | 11h 19m | 7:36 AM - 8:08 AM | 6:23 PM - 6:55 PM |
| Oct 25 | 7:37 AM | 6:54 PM | 11h 17m | 7:37 AM - 8:09 AM | 6:22 PM - 6:54 PM |
| Oct 26 | 7:37 AM | 6:53 PM | 11h 16m | 7:37 AM - 8:09 AM | 6:21 PM - 6:53 PM |
| Oct 27 | 7:38 AM | 6:52 PM | 11h 14m | 7:38 AM - 8:10 AM | 6:20 PM - 6:52 PM |
| Oct 28 | 7:39 AM | 6:52 PM | 11h 13m | 7:39 AM - 8:11 AM | 6:19 PM - 6:52 PM |
| Oct 29 | 7:39 AM | 6:51 PM | 11h 11m | 7:39 AM - 8:12 AM | 6:19 PM - 6:51 PM |
| Oct 30 | 7:40 AM | 6:50 PM | 11h 10m | 7:40 AM - 8:12 AM | 6:18 PM - 6:50 PM |
| Oct 31 | 7:41 AM | 6:49 PM | 11h 8m | 7:41 AM - 8:13 AM | 6:17 PM - 6:49 PM |

What is golden hour in St. Petersburg, Florida?
Golden hour in St. Petersburg, Florida refers to the period shortly after sunrise and before sunset when the sun is low in the sky, creating warm, soft lighting ideal for photography.
